🎨 How to Make Halloween Embroidery Stand Out
Use metallic threads (gold, silver, orange) for shimmer in low light.
Opt for large, central motifs like pumpkins, ghosts, or Labubu characters.
Add glow-in-the-dark threads for a playful nighttime effect.
✨ Popular Embroidery Variants on Black Hoodies
Classic spooky motifs: bats 🦇, pumpkins 🎃, witches 🧙♀️.
Pop-culture mashups: Labubu, anime ghosts, gothic fonts.
Minimalistic accents: spider webs 🕸️ on sleeves, stitched quotes in neon colors.
